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Elding Whale Watching.
- Book your tour in advance, especially during peak seasons, to secure your spot.
- Dress in layers and bring waterproof clothing to stay comfortable during the trip.
- Don't forget your camera to capture the breathtaking sights of whales and the stunning Icelandic landscape.
- Arrive early to enjoy the informational displays and prepare for your adventure.
